The NVIDIA RTX PRO 2000 Blackwell Graphics Card is a compact professional workstation GPU built for AI, CAD, engineering, and content creation. Featuring 16GB ECC GDDR7 memory, 4,352 CUDA cores, 5th Gen Tensor Cores, PCIe 5.0, and up to 545 AI TOPS, it delivers powerful performance, enterprise reliability, and exceptional energy efficiency in a 70W Small Form Factor design.

Features
- Built on the latest NVIDIA Blackwell Architecture for AI, CAD, 3D design, and professional visualization.
- 16GB GDDR7 ECC memory provides reliable performance for AI models, engineering projects, and creative workflows.
- 4,352 CUDA Cores deliver fast graphics rendering and GPU-accelerated computing.
- 5th Generation Tensor Cores accelerate AI inference, generative AI, and machine learning applications.
- 4th Generation Ray Tracing Cores deliver realistic lighting, reflections, and shadows for professional rendering.
- Up to 545 AI TOPS for AI-assisted workflows and edge inference.
- 288 GB/s memory bandwidth ensures smooth performance with complex datasets and 3D models.
- Supports PCIe 5.0 x8 for high-speed workstation connectivity.
- 1× 9th Generation NVENC and 1× 6th Generation NVDEC accelerate video encoding and decoding.
- Four Mini DisplayPort 2.1b outputs support up to four high-resolution displays.
- Compact Small Form Factor (SFF) design fits space-constrained workstations.
- 70W Total Board Power (TBP) requires no external power connector, making installation simple.
- NVIDIA RTX Enterprise Drivers provide certified compatibility with leading professional applications.
Specifications
| Product Name | NVIDIA RTX PRO 2000 Blackwell |
| GPU Architecture | NVIDIA Blackwell |
| Graphics Memory | 16GB GDDR7 ECC (Error Correcting Code) |
| Memory Type | GDDR7 |
| Memory Interface | 128-bit |
| Memory Bandwidth | 288 GB/s |
| CUDA Cores | 4,352 |
| Tensor Cores | 5th Generation |
| Ray Tracing Cores | 4th Generation |
| AI Performance | Up to 545 AI TOPS |
| Single Precision (FP32) | Up to 17 TFLOPS |
| Ray Tracing Performance | Up to 52 TFLOPS |
| PCI Express Interface | PCIe 5.0 x8 |
| Display Outputs | 4 × Mini DisplayPort 2.1b |
| Maximum Resolution | Up to 8K (7680 × 4320) |
| Maximum Displays Supported | Up to 4 Displays |
| Video Encoder | 1 × 9th Generation NVENC |
| Video Decoder | 1 × 6th Generation NVDEC |
| Supported Video Codecs | AV1, H.264, H.265 (HEVC) Encode & Decode |
| Power Consumption (TBP) | 70W |
| Power Connector | No External Power Connector Required (PCIe Slot Powered) |
| Cooling Solution | Active Cooling |
| Form Factor | Small Form Factor (SFF), Dual Slot |
| Card Dimensions | 2.7 in (H) × 6.6 in (L) |
| Graphics APIs | DirectX 12, OpenGL 4.6, Vulkan 1.4 |
| Compute APIs | CUDA 12.8, OpenCL 3.0 |
| ECC Memory Support | Yes |
| Operating System Support | Windows 11, Windows 10 (64-bit), Linux |
| Professional Drivers | NVIDIA RTX Enterprise Drivers |
| Virtual Reality | VR Ready |
| Recommended Applications | AI Development, CAD, Architecture, Engineering, Product Design, 3D Modeling, Rendering, BIM, Video Editing, Scientific Visualization, Edge AI |
| Professional Software Certifications | Autodesk AutoCAD, Revit, Maya, 3ds Max, SolidWorks, CATIA, Siemens NX, PTC Creo, Blender, Adobe Creative Cloud, DaVinci Resolve, Ansys, and other professional workstation applications |
